Similar Myc Levels and bcl-2 Suppression of Myc-induced Apoptosis in Premalignant Thymocytes of Myc;Cre and Myc;Cre;bcl-2 Transgenic Fish. (A) Western blot analyses reveal no significant differences in EGFP-mMyc protein levels in premaligant T-cells of Myc;Cre (n=4) versus Myc;Cre;bcl-2 (n=4) transgenic fish (P=0.67), despite variations of EGFP-mMyc levels among the individual fish and the striking levels of EGFP-zbcl-2 protein. Actin levels serve as a loading control. (B) FACS analysis of Annexin V-positive cells was performed on GFP-expressing control thymocytes of rag2-GFP (GFP) transgenic fish or premaligant thymocytes fromMyc;Cre and Myc;Cre;bcl-2 transgenic fish, respectively. Percentages of AnnexinV-positive cells for GFP vs. Myc;Cre; mean± SD: 8.72 ± 2.72 vs. 91.2 ± 15.77; Myc;Cre vs. Myc;Cre;bcl-2; mean± SD: 91.2 ± 15.77 vs. 49.13 ± 23.27; n=3 fish per group. |
